Welcome!

My main research interest are the families of the former Amt Battenberg in North Hesse, Germany, from the late middle ages (around 1300) until today. This includes, but is not limited to, a large fraction of my own ancestry. I currently live in Marburg, 30 km south of Battenberg.

Starting around 2008, I have first transcribed and then indexed the church records of the villages Laisa and Holzhausen (Eder), for the years 1624 until the 1960s.[1]

In 2020, I have published a book (in two volumes) about Battenberg (Eder) and the surrounding villages, discussing the surviving documents that predate the introduction of church records (pre-1600).[2][3][4] This involves the following places: Battenberg (Eder), Rennertehausen, Berghofen, Allendorf (Eder), Battenfeld, Dodenau, Reddighausen, Laisa, Holzhausen (Eder), Eifa, Münchhausen, Wollmar, and (to a lesser degree) Hatzfeld (Eder), Birkenbringhausen, Frohnhausen, Oberasphe and Simtshausen.

More recently, I have been working on transcriptions and an index for the church records of Battenberg itself (1624-1807), as well as the parish of Battenfeld, which includes Allendorf, Rennertehausen, Berghofen and Osterfeld (1574-1808). Data for Kröge is found in both.

Asteroid (128345) Danielbamberger

My interests beyond genealogy include astronomy. I am a co-founder of the Northolt Branch Observatory, from where I observe Near Earth asteroids since 2015.[5][6][7][8] I am also an active editor on the English Wikipedia.[9]
